Been installing fast chargers for 10 years now for a few different company's and huge amount of the funding has always been government funds. A lot of grants and subsidies. The bigger problem is finding contractors that want to do the jobs. There small jobs that have several different trades. It's hard to find sub contractors to do the work because the part of the job you need them to do is so minor and when you do find them the bids are very high to make it worth doing the job. This means you have to find small contractors that can do the whole job themselves or at least most of it. Although there small jobs they can be pretty complex. There are a lot of obstacles such as working in a parking lot that has a lot of auto and foot traffic, saw cutting and excavating around existing utilities, running conduit to the stores existing electrical panel which in many cases is on the opposite side of the store, adding ADA ramps and sometimes removing and repaving the parking stalls to meet the max slope requirements for ADA stalls and many other obstacle's. And your have to do all this in a space of about 5 parking stalls that have to be fenced off the entire time. It's not easy to fit all the material, construction equipment and charging equipment in a space that small and still have room to work. And then you throw in the fact that you have to have good coordinating with the store manager, city inspectors and in a lot of cases utility company's to get the electrical powered up. There just aren't a lot of small contractors that can or want to deal with it. Which is part of the reason charging stations aren't be installed at a faster pace. Last time I looked there were 85 jobs (charging stations) ready for bids and installation just in our area. Originally electric cars had a high frequency switching device which can take DC from the battery and make variable frequency AC to drive the motors at different speeds, which was properly called the "inverter". Engineers realized that they could use the same circuitry to take AC from the power grid and charge the battery, instead of having a separate AC - DC charger. Rather than give this multifunction device a new, more technically correct name - most manufacturers still refer to it as the "inverter" despite it doing more complex conversion.

@@mark123655 its not a voltage issue. CCS (both types) is an AC connector plus two DC connectors, using the comms channel of the AC connector. J1772 (the AC connector on CCS1) is a single phase connector (american 220v is actually a single phase that hasn't been center tapped to produce 2 "phases"). the type 2 connector (the AC connector on CCS2) is a three phase connector. "400v" is generally 3 phase, with 220v between any one phase and ground, which gives 400v between any two phases.

I think there's only one major detail left out and that's how fast charging has it's downsides. Generally the faster a battery can charge, the more capacity has to be sacrificed in the form of insulating and separating different parts of the battery from one another. With this, percentages of charging done can be misleading. A battery twice the capacity of another battery, charging at half the percentage over the same time period is charging at the same speed. Also the faster a battery is consistently charged and depleted, the lower the longevity of the battery. Explaining concepts like this would make it so the whole idea of charging a certain percentage over a certain time period wouldn't be seen as the full picture, like it is currently.

Just to point out (sorry as an electronics engineer it really bugged me!) - an inverter is not just another name for a 'converter'. An inverter specifically converts DC into AC. A rectifier converts AC into DC. The 250kW unit you showed in the video is completely unsuitable for charging a car from the power grid. You'd need either a 250kW rectifier to convert to DC (for DC fast charging), or just a transformer to supply AC, which will be rectified by the internal rectifier on the car. And while EVs do have an on-board inverter (that's partly what makes the 'whining' sound characteristic of some EVs), it's for driving the AC motor from the DC battery.
